“In every generation on the island of Fennbirn, a set of triplets is born: three queens, all equal heirs to the crown and each possessor of a coveted magic. Mirabella is a fierce elemental, able to spark hungry flames or vicious storms at the snap of her fingers. Katharine is a poisoner, one who can ingest the deadliest poisons without so much as a stomach ache. Arsinoe, a naturalist, is said to have the ability to bloom the reddest rose and control the fiercest of lions.

“But becoming the Queen Crowned isn’t solely a matter of royal birth. Each sister has to fight for it. And it’s not just a game of win or lose - it’s life or death. The night the sisters turn sixteen, the battle begins. The last queen standing gets the crown.”

Three Dark Crowns is a deliciously dark, incredibly compelling and gripping story. I couldn’t help but root for every one of the sisters by reading their different perspectives. The political intrigue was just great, with all the different interactions between characters and the fiendish plots that were formed. It left me on tenterhooks and I couldn’t put the book down.

I physically need to read more from Fennbirn and I can’t wait to see what happens next for the three Queens and my personal favourite character, Jules. This is another series I’m definitely obsessed with.
